CFLAGS

這是一個 CMake 環境變數。它的初始值取自呼叫程序的環境。

加入編譯 C 檔案時使用的預設編譯旗標。

CMake 會使用此環境變數的值,結合其工具鏈的內建預設旗標,來初始化和儲存 CMAKE_C_FLAGS 快取條目。這會在第一次為 C 語言配置建置樹時發生。對於任何配置執行(包括第一次),如果已經定義了 CMAKE_C_FLAGS 變數,則會忽略環境變數。

另請參閱 CMAKE_C_FLAGS_INIT